In today's digital-first business landscape, enterprises require robust, scalable, and secure mobile applications to stay competitive and meet evolving customer expectations. Android, commanding over 70% of the global mobile operating system market share, has become the platform of choice for businesses seeking to expand their digital footprint. Professional Android app development solutions tailored specifically for enterprises can transform business operations, enhance customer engagement, and drive substantial revenue growth.
Understanding Enterprise Android Development Needs
Enterprise-level Android applications differ significantly from consumer apps in terms of complexity, security requirements, and integration capabilities. Organizations need solutions that can handle large user bases, process significant data volumes, integrate seamlessly with existing infrastructure, and maintain the highest security standards. The best android development company understands these unique requirements and delivers solutions that align with enterprise objectives while ensuring scalability and future-readiness.
Modern enterprises face challenges including legacy system integration, data security concerns, cross-platform compatibility, and the need for real-time analytics. A comprehensive Android development solution addresses these challenges through strategic planning, cutting-edge technology implementation, and ongoing support. Whether developing customer-facing applications, internal operational tools, or partner portals, enterprise Android apps must deliver exceptional performance while maintaining brand consistency and user experience excellence.
Core Components of Enterprise Android Solutions
Professional enterprise Android development encompasses several critical components that distinguish business applications from standard consumer apps. These include advanced security protocols such as multi-factor authentication, data encryption, and secure API integration. Enterprise apps also require sophisticated user management systems, role-based access controls, and comprehensive audit trails to meet compliance requirements across various industries and regulations.
Integration capabilities represent another essential aspect of enterprise Android solutions. Applications must connect seamlessly with enterprise resource planning (ERP) systems, customer relationship management (CRM) platforms, content management systems, and various third-party services. The best android development company possesses deep expertise in API development, middleware solutions, and data synchronization technologies that enable smooth information flow across organizational systems.
Scalability and performance optimization are paramount for enterprise applications expected to serve thousands or millions of users simultaneously. Professional development teams implement cloud-based architectures, efficient caching mechanisms, and optimized database queries to ensure applications perform reliably under demanding conditions. Load balancing, failover mechanisms, and disaster recovery planning form integral parts of enterprise-grade Android solutions.
Industry-Specific Android Development Solutions
Different industries have unique requirements that demand specialized Android development approaches. Healthcare organizations need HIPAA-compliant applications with secure patient data handling, telemedicine capabilities, and integration with electronic health records. Financial services require applications meeting stringent security standards, supporting complex transaction processing, and providing real-time financial data analysis.
Retail and e-commerce enterprises benefit from Android applications featuring advanced inventory management, personalized shopping experiences, secure payment processing, and loyalty program integration. Manufacturing companies require applications supporting Internet of Things (IoT) device connectivity, real-time production monitoring, supply chain tracking, and predictive maintenance capabilities. Technoyuga specializes in developing industry-specific Android solutions that address sector-unique challenges while leveraging best practices and proven methodologies.
Education institutions increasingly rely on Android applications for remote learning, student engagement, administrative management, and parent communication. These applications must support multimedia content delivery, real-time collaboration, assessment tools, and progress tracking while ensuring data privacy and accessibility compliance. The best android development company brings vertical industry expertise that accelerates development timelines and ensures solutions meet regulatory and operational requirements.
Advanced Technologies in Enterprise Android Development
Modern enterprise Android applications leverage cutting-edge technologies to deliver innovative features and competitive advantages. Artificial intelligence and machine learning integration enable intelligent automation, predictive analytics, personalized user experiences, and advanced data processing capabilities. Natural language processing powers voice-activated features, chatbots, and intelligent search functionality that enhance user productivity and satisfaction.
Augmented reality (AR) and virtual reality (VR) technologies are transforming enterprise applications across industries. Retail applications use AR for virtual product trials, manufacturing leverages AR for maintenance guidance, and real estate employs VR for property tours. Internet of Things integration connects Android applications with smart devices, sensors, and equipment, enabling remote monitoring, control, and data collection across distributed operations.
Blockchain technology integration provides enterprise Android applications with enhanced security, transparent transaction tracking, and decentralized data management capabilities. This proves particularly valuable for supply chain management, contract verification, and secure credential management. The best android development company stays current with emerging technologies and understands how to implement them effectively within enterprise contexts to deliver measurable business value.
Security and Compliance in Enterprise Android Apps
Security represents a critical concern for enterprise Android applications handling sensitive business and customer data. Professional development solutions implement multiple security layers including secure coding practices, penetration testing, vulnerability assessments, and ongoing security monitoring. Data encryption both at rest and in transit, secure authentication mechanisms, and certificate pinning protect against unauthorized access and data breaches.
Compliance with industry regulations and standards is non-negotiable for enterprise applications. Depending on the industry and geographic location, applications must meet requirements such as GDPR, CCPA, HIPAA, PCI DSS, SOC 2, and various other regulatory frameworks. Professional development teams possess deep understanding of compliance requirements and implement necessary controls, documentation, and audit capabilities from the project's inception.
Mobile device management (MDM) and mobile application management (MAM) integration allows organizations to maintain control over enterprise applications deployed across diverse device ecosystems. Features such as remote wipe, application containerization, and policy enforcement ensure corporate data remains secure even on employee-owned devices. The best android development company designs security architectures that balance user convenience with organizational security requirements, ensuring adoption while maintaining protection.
Development Methodology and Project Management
Successful enterprise Android development projects require structured methodologies and rigorous project management practices. Agile development approaches enable iterative progress, regular stakeholder feedback, and flexible adaptation to changing requirements. Sprint-based development with continuous integration and continuous deployment (CI/CD) pipelines ensures rapid delivery of functional increments while maintaining code quality and stability.
Comprehensive discovery and requirements analysis phases ensure development teams fully understand business objectives, user needs, technical constraints, and integration requirements before coding begins. Detailed technical specifications, wireframes, and prototypes provide clarity and alignment among stakeholders, reducing costly changes during later development stages. Regular communication, progress reporting, and demonstration sessions keep projects on track and stakeholders informed throughout the development lifecycle.
Quality assurance represents a continuous process throughout enterprise Android development rather than a final phase. Automated testing frameworks, manual testing procedures, performance testing, security testing, and user acceptance testing ensure applications meet functional requirements and quality standards. Post-launch support including monitoring, maintenance, updates, and enhancement ensures applications continue delivering value as business needs evolve and the Android ecosystem advances.
Choosing the Right Development Partner
Selecting the appropriate development partner significantly impacts enterprise Android project success. Organizations should evaluate potential partners based on technical expertise, industry experience, portfolio quality, development methodology, communication practices, and post-launch support capabilities. The best android development company demonstrates proven track records with similar enterprise projects, technical certifications, and client testimonials validating their capabilities.
Successful partnerships are built on transparent communication, aligned expectations, and collaborative problem-solving. Development partners should function as strategic advisors rather than mere coding resources, contributing insights on technology selection, architecture design, and feature prioritization. Cultural compatibility, time zone considerations, and communication infrastructure also influence partnership effectiveness, particularly for long-term enterprise engagements requiring ongoing collaboration and support.
Enterprise Android development represents a strategic investment in digital transformation, customer engagement, and operational efficiency. By partnering with experienced development experts who understand enterprise requirements, organizations can create powerful mobile solutions that drive business growth, enhance competitive positioning, and deliver exceptional user experiences across the Android ecosystem.